A fine and large Italian early 20th century gildwood carved and gilt-brass mounted server buffet with marble top. The rectangular fruit wood body with four front doors ornately carved with shields, scrolls and acanthus details, surmounted with pierced gilt-metal hardware, all raised on a heavily carved gilded base with cabriolet legs and a floral design centered with carved seashells and fitted with a veined white marble top. Circa: Florence, 1900.
Measures: height: 41 1/8 inches (104.5 cm)
Width: 101 1/2 inches (257.8 cm)
Depth: 27 inches (68.6 cm).
